European Adventure: 7-Day Itinerary

Tuesday, May 28: London, United Kingdom

Start your European adventure in the vibrant city of London. In the morning, visit the iconic Buckingham Palace and witness the Changing of the Guard ceremony. Explore the British Museum in the afternoon, home to a vast collection of art and artifacts. As evening sets in, take a stroll along the scenic River Thames and enjoy the stunning views of the city.

  • Buckingham Palace: £0, 2 hours
  • British Museum: £0, 3 hours
  • Scenic River Thames: Free, 1 hour
Wednesday, May 29: Paris, France

Travel from London to the romantic city of Paris. Start your morning by visiting the iconic Eiffel Tower and enjoy breathtaking views of the city. In the afternoon, explore the Louvre Museum, home to world-famous artworks including the Mona Lisa. As the evening approaches, take a leisurely stroll along the Seine River, admiring the picturesque bridges and charming cafes.

  • Eiffel Tower: €15, 2 hours
  • Louvre Museum: €17, 4 hours
  • Seine River: Free, 1 hour
Thursday, May 30: Rome, Italy

Head to the eternal city of Rome in the morning. Begin your day by visiting the magnificent Colosseum and delve into the history of ancient Rome. In the afternoon, explore the Vatican City and marvel at the stunning Sistine Chapel and St. Peter's Basilica. As the sun sets, wander through the charming streets of Trastevere and indulge in delicious Italian cuisine.

  • Colosseum: €16, 3 hours
  • Vatican City: €17, 4 hours
  • Trastevere: €0, 2 hours
Friday, May 31: Barcelona, Spain

Fly to the vibrant city of Barcelona. Start your day by visiting the famous Sagrada Familia, an architectural masterpiece by Antoni Gaudí.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ant streets of Las Ramblas and enjoy shopping and street performances. As evening sets in, head to the Gothic Quarter and savor delicious tapas in a cozy local restaurant.

  • Sagrada Familia: €20, 3 hours
  • Las Ramblas: €0, 2 hours
  • Gothic Quarter: €0, 2 hours
Saturday, June 1: Amsterdam, Netherlands

Travel to the charming city of Amsterdam. Begin your day by visiting the Anne Frank House and learn about the history of World War II. In the afternoon, explore the famous Van Gogh Museum and admire the works of the renowned artist. As the evening approaches, take a scenic canal cruise and enjoy the picturesque views of the city.

  • Anne Frank House: €10, 2 hours
  • Van Gogh Museum: €19, 3 hours
  • Canal Cruise: €16, 1 hour
Sunday, June 2: Prague, Czech Republic

Fly to the enchanting city of Prague. Start your day by visiting the Prague Castle and enjoy panoramic views of the city. In the afternoon, wander through the charming streets of Old Town Square and admire the stunning Astronomical Clock. As the sun sets, head to the lively Wenceslas Square and indulge in traditional Czech cuisine.

  • Prague Castle: CZK 350, 3 hours
  • Old Town Square: Free, 2 hours
  • Wenceslas Square: Free, 2 hours
Monday, June 3: Athens, Greece

Travel to the ancient city of Athens. Begin your day by exploring the majestic Acropolis and marvel at the Parthenon. In the afternoon, visit the fascinating Acropolis Museum and learn about the rich history of ancient Greece. As the evening sets in, wander through the lively Plaka neighborhood and enjoy traditional Greek music and cuisine.

  • Acropolis: €20, 3 hours
  • Acropolis Museum: €10, 2 hours
  • Plaka: €0, 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Europe, make sure to visit the hidden gems and local favorites. In London, venture to Camden Town and explore its vibrant markets. In Paris, visit Montmartre and enjoy the bohemian atmosphere. In Rome, explore the charming district of Trastevere for a more local experience. Barcelona offers the picturesque Park Güell for stunning views. In Amsterdam, discover the Jordaan neighborhood for its charming canals and trendy cafés. Prague's Lesser Town offers a quieter atmosphere away from the crowds. Lastly, in Athens, explore the charming neighborhood of Plaka for its traditional tavernas and winding streets.
